It is true that due to the positive impact musicians had by providing music to soldiers returning from World War II who were in hospitals in the USA, music therapy began to develop as a profession. In fact, the first University Music Therapy training program in the USA was established during the 1940s. This happened in the wake of the recognition of the therapeutic effect of music on soldiers affected by the war, aligning with a wider appreciation of music's universal capacity to convey emotions and affect psychological states.
